POSITION TITLE: Early Head Start-Child Care (EHS-CC) Family Advocate DEPARTMENT: Early Childhood Services LOCATION(S): Brooklyn, NY REPORTS TO: Early Head Start-Child Care (EHS-CC) Family Services Coordinator SALARY RANGE: $41,611 - $43,232 (annually); benefits include medical, dental, vision, prescription, life insurance, 401K plan, 24 vacation days per year and personal and sick time-off. DATE: July 2025 SCHEDULE: Monday-Friday, 8am - 4pm, or 9am - 5pm. Schedule may vary due to program needs. JOB SUMMARY: Responsible for carrying out the Parent, Family, & Community Engagement (PFCE) components of the program in connection with partner’s School Readiness Goals (SRG), & areas of Eligibility, Recruitment, Selection, Enrollment & Attendance (ERSEA) to ensure high quality service delivery in accordance with local, state, & federal regulations. Required to spend 80% field work and 20% planning/record keeping/training. EDUCATION, EXPERIENCE AND REQUIREMENTS:
- AA degree in social work, human services, family services, counseling or related field, or
- Bachelor’s Degree in Social Work, human services, family services, counseling or a related field
- Experience working with families of children from birth to 36 months.
- Demonstrated knowledge of community resources & how to access services for children & families.
- Ability to work effectively as a member of a team & independently in the field.
- Meet all employee health requirements in Head Start Performance Standards (revised 2016)/Head Start Act 2007.
- Bilingual (fluent in English/Spanish) Preferred.
PRE-EMPLOYMENT REQUIREMENTS:
- Successfully clear; NYS DOI Fingerprint Screening, NYS Central Registry Clearance, Sex Offender Registry Clearance, three (3) reference checks, physical examination with updated TB test, Tdap, MMR, varicella (fees may apply).
- Meet all employee health requirements in Article 47 (DOHMH) and Head Start performance standards.
- Mandated Reporter training certificate (every 2 years) and comply with agency’s policy and procedure regarding identification and reporting of child abuse and neglect.
- Obtain First Aid/CPR and Preventive infectious diseases certificate within the first year of employment.
- Meets all health requirements in Article 47 (DOHMH) and Head Start Performance standards.
- If hired, Grand Street requires all potential employees to provide proof of full COVID-19 vaccination and booster.
ESSENTIAL D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ES:
- Collaborate with partner staff & GSS manager/leadership team to provide ongoing comprehensive services to enrolled children & families in alignment with Head Start Performance Standards/Head Start Act 2007
- Implement Trauma Informed services and integrate practices when working with families.
- Case Management & support for families – program center based & family child care partners; data entry management & reporting, planning & follow up for delivery of services including appropriate & timely referrals for mental health, crisis intervention, health/nutrition, employment, & education/literacy.
- Implement the parent engagement curriculum
- Work closely with families to build trusting relationships; to develop & progress towards meeting goals; motivate & inspire families to participate & be involved in their child’s education; & demonstrate the ability to measure individual & overall impact.
- Participate in home visits for all assigned children & families as needed.
- Develop & maintain working relationships with community agencies & act as a liaison to support families in alignment with FPA, PFCE, & SRG.
- Support Eligibility, Recruitment, Selection, Enrollment, & Attendance (ERSEA) efforts of partners for eligible participants to ensure full enrollment of EHS-CC Partnership slots and help with recruitment of families.
- Assist in the planning & facilitation of parent involvement activities & events.
